Sweetfuels CDCA Div Two

Ashton Keynes 128-2; Fairford II 127-8

FAIRFORD II suffered their third successive defeat, this time away at Ashton Keynes, where they won the toss and elected to bat before struggling against accurate bowling, a slow wicket and well-placed fielders on a grassy outfield.

An unfortunate run-out off the first ball of the match set the tone for the innings as Fairford’s run-rate barely got above three an over, despite the best efforts of Simon Embleton-Smith (49), David Taylor (23) and Colin Denness (31*). Skipper Tom Waller was the pick of the home bowlers with 3-29 as Ashton Keynes put in a very good team performance in the field.

When the home side went into bat, openers George Ford (41) and James Collister (26) scored more freely than Fairford’s batsmen, although both eventually fell to Denness, one to his best ball of the day, the other to arguably his worst, thanks to an excellent catch at deep mid-off by Aidan Van Der Heiden.

Mike Grier finished matters in the 28th over of the innings, thanks to a lively 42*.
